#36e8db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#36e8db is composed of 21.2% red, 91%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.6%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 175.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.5% and a lightness of 56.1%. #36e8db color hex could be obtained by blending #6cffff with #00d1b7.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#36e8db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#36e8db has RGB values of R:54, G:232,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 3598555.

Hex triplet 36e8db #36e8db
RGB Decimal 54, 232, 219 rgb(54,232,219)
RGB Percent 21.2, 91, 85.9 rgb(21.2%,91%,85.9%)
CMYK 77, 0, 6, 9
HSL 175.6°, 79.5, 56.1 hsl(175.6,79.5%,56.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 175.6°, 76.7, 91
Web Safe 33ffcc #33ffcc
CIE-LAB 83.761, -45.693, -6.197
XYZ 43.16, 63.608, 77.017
xyY 0.235, 0.346, 63.608
CIE-LCH 83.761, 46.111, 187.723
CIE-LUV 83.761, -62.384, -2.482
Hunter-Lab 79.754, -42.973, -1.427
Binary 00110110, 11101000, 11011011

Shades and Tints of #36e8db

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a0a is the darkest color, while #f8f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#36e8db

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c9291 is the less saturated color, while #25f9ea is the most saturated one.
